PULTE FAMILY CHARITABLE FOUNDATION
The Pulte Family Charitable Foundation is a family foundation rooted in faith, service, and the belief that every person deserves to live with dignity. Guided by the Seven Corporal Works of Mercy, the Foundation works across America and around the world to serve society’s most vulnerable — including disadvantaged youth, the elderly, individuals with disabilities, families living in poverty, and communities in need of shelter, food, education, and hope.
Monarca carries forward a legacy that began with the Foundation’s founder, William J. “Bill” Pulte, a homebuilder who understood that a house is never just a structure. A true home offers safety, stability, belonging, and the opportunity for a family to build a better life. That belief is at the heart of Monarca.

As the lead philanthropic partner in this effort, the Pulte Family Charitable Foundation is helping bring Monarca to life for essential worker families in the Immokalee region. Through its partnership with Nuestra Señora de la Vivienda Community Foundation, the Foundation is helping raise the resources needed to build 184 quality two-, three-, and four-bedroom homes, a Community Center, green space, a five-acre lake, and programs designed to strengthen families for generations. Monarca reflects what the Foundation has always believed: when we provide shelter, restore dignity, and walk with families in need, we help create a future filled with greater possibility.
